§ 17B-2a-809 — Public transit districts to submit agendas and minutes of board meetings.

(1)The board of trustees of each public transit district shall submit to each constituent entity, as defined in Section 17B-1-701:
(1)(a) a copy of the board agenda and a notice of the location and time of the board meeting within the same time frame provided to members of the board prior to the meeting; and
(1)(b) a copy of the minutes of board meetings within five working days following approval of the minutes.
(2)The board may submit notices, agendas, and minutes by electronic mail if agreed to by the constituent entity as defined under Section 17B-1-701.
